Discovering Sustainable Siding Options


Allow's begin with siding. Conventional materials like plastic and light weight aluminum have actually been extensively made use of for years due to their affordability and easy installation. But they typically fall short in eco-friendliness. Today's lasting options include fiber cement, wood composite, reclaimed timber, and crafted timber items.


Fiber concrete home siding, for instance, uses a balanced blend of strength and eco-conscious design. It's made from a mix of sand, cement, and cellulose fibers and can last years with very little upkeep. Engineered wood house siding reproduces the look of typical wood while utilizing less timber, lowering logging. Redeemed wood offers old products a new life, and when secured appropriately, it can stand up to the elements equally as well as new lumber.

Environment-friendly Roofing That Works Hard and Looks Great


Roof plays a just as essential function in producing a lasting home. A poorly protected or maturing roof can result in energy loss and higher energy costs. On the flip side, an effective roofing can assist control interior temperature level, reflect solar heat, and even contribute to rainwater harvesting.


Steel roof covering is a standout selection for eco-minded homeowners. It's typically made with recycled products and is itself 100% recyclable at the end of its life. It mirrors sunshine, which aids maintain your home colder in the summer season, reducing reliance on air conditioning. Its long lifespan also suggests less material waste over time.


One more interesting trend is the rise of "amazing roofings." These systems utilize reflective finishes or lighter-colored products to deflect sunlight and absorb much less warm. This can make a considerable difference in warmer climates and city locations, where warm absorption can drive up interior temperature levels and utility costs.


If you're seeking something absolutely cutting-edge, eco-friendly roof coverings-- additionally called living roofings-- are turning heads. These are split systems that support plant, enhancing insulation and air quality while lowering stormwater overflow. While not suitable for every single home style, they show exactly how much sustainable style can go when imagination meets obligation.
